The Portugal flag holds a strong port-state-control (PSC) reputation across both Paris MoU and Tokyo MoU regimes. It has ratified MLC 2006, which gives seafarers the international right to inspection and complaint. A safer flag does not mean every vessel is safe — operator + classification society still drive day-to-day conditions.
Has Portugal ratified the Maritime Labour Convention (MLC 2006)?
Yes — Portugal has ratified MLC 2006 (ratified 2013). Seafarers serving on Portugal-flagged vessels are entitled to make MLC complaints through the flag administration, port state, or seafarer welfare organisations such as the ITF.
How do I file a complaint against a Portugal-flagged vessel or operator?
Complaints can be lodged with the Autoridade MarÃtima Nacional (AMN) via their official complaint procedure. Under MLC 2006, complaints may also be lodged with the port-state authority of any MLC-ratified port. The ITF and seafarer welfare organisations (Mission to Seafarers, Stella Maris, Sailors' Society) can advocate on your behalf. Keep contract, wage records, and seaman's book ready.
What port-state-control rating does Portugal have?
Paris MoU rating: white. Tokyo MoU rating: white. PSC ratings classify flags by inspection and detention history. White / low-risk flags face fewer PSC inspections; black / high-risk flags face more frequent inspection and a higher detention rate.
Is Portugal on the ITF Flag of Convenience (FoC) list?
No — Portugal is not currently on the ITF Flag of Convenience list. Seafarers retain general ITF-channel access for advocacy and abandonment response regardless of FoC status.
